NORTHAMPTON — Should Northampton create a municipal broadband network?
That's the primary question behind newly launched city surveys for residents and businesses.
The city has been looking into the possibility of municipal broadband, and residents have formed the Northampton Community Network, a group that has been pushing for a public high-speed network. The market survey is part of consulting firm Design Nine’s study of the issue in Northampton, a project the city commissioned.
“Now we want a deeper understanding of what Northampton consumers expect from their internet service, and to what extent those expectations are currently met,” Mayor David Narkewicz said in a statement. “This survey data will be critical to determining our next steps on municipal broadband and I urge everyone to participate and to encourage their friends and neighbors to take the survey.”
The survey can be accessed online at www.northamptonma.gov/2223/Municipal-Broadband-Study, and paper copies will be sent in the mail, according to the mayor’s office. Residents and businesses are encouraged to fill out the survey by April 23.
